Have a R5A16 installation running fine except for one thing. I do not use the automatic commercial flagging feature. I have it off in setup. I manually cut the commercials in the edit mode. However, I notice that when a new recording is made cpu time is spent on a queue job that "thinks" it is marking commercials. If I go look at the cutlist after this useless activity there are no commercials flagged. Even thought the message shown in the MythWeb job queue display says "Finished : <some number> breaks found". Why is useless processing going on when the feature is turned off in setup? Have not found anything similar in the forums so far. |

Auto-flagging is often hit or miss, which is why skipping the detected commericals isn't the default. However it can profitably be used as a basis for manual marking. When you go into manual edit mode try hitting the "z" key... |
